              CA ON0034 10-132-S5-F1 · Dossier · May 6, 2011
              Fait partie de Valerie Overend fonds
              This file consists of briefing materials for the Bridge the Gap with Women in Skilled Trades and Technologies, the Saskatchewan’s Summit held in May 6th,2011 in Saskatoon. It includes a select annoyed bibliography of Canadian resources compiled by the Saskatchewan apprenticeship and trades certification commission (SATCC) and a summit Edition Newsletter of May 2011.
              CA ON0034 10-132-S1-SS1-F16 · Dossier · July, 1976
              Fait partie de Valerie Overend fonds
              This file contains a booklet on "Vocational Readiness Programs for Young Women", a "How-to" Handbook. This booklet was compiled as a part of a 1975 International Women's Year Project funded by the Women's Program, Secretary of State. The University Women's Club of Saskatoon, as an International Women's Year project, explored ways in which the community might become involved in establishing vocational readiness and life planning programs for young women. specifically, the project committee and, finally, to compile a "How-to" manual containing its research and conclusions.
              What Now ? ? ?
              CA ON0034 10-132-S1-SS1-F15 · Dossier · 1975
              Fait partie de Valerie Overend fonds
              This file contains a "life planning kit" for high school girls. The kit was assembled by Sheila Rowswell with financial assistance under the YES programme, and with some direction from the Department of Continuing Education, College of Education, University of Saskatchewan. The University Women's Club of Saskatoon, Canadian Federation of University Women also contributed to the kit, as part of their International Women's Year project. The Education Committee of CFUW served as advisers. Funding for the project came from the Department of the Secretary of State. Its contents: What now?               CA ON0034 10-008-S2-F4 · Dossier · 1977
              Fait partie de Toronto Wages for Housework Committee fonds
              This file contains a letter from the secretary of the Gay Community Centre of Saskatoon (GCCS), a list of suggested topics and itinerary for the 5th annual Gay Rights Conference, and letters and correspondences from the national Conference Planning Committee and Wages Due Lesbians. It also contains the final bilingual agenda for the Toward a Gay Community Conference (29 June to 3 July 1977), a registration form, a response to the president of Gays of Ottawa, and a newsletter scan headlining a gay march in Saskatoon.
